![](https://image.tmdb.org/t/p/original/7W8Wzo1zLMOOjVzVgA63wJM512H.jpg)
The World Before Time - S15.E6 - Ancient Aliens
Shocking new evidence reveals that advanced civilizations might have existed on Earth tens of thousands of years ago. Is it possible that a technologically advanced society thrived on Earth then’ And did they leave behind a record that they lived alongside extraterrestrial beings’
The World Before Time - S15.E6 - Ancient Aliens
February 29, 2020
Video reviews
There are no video reviews for this tv episode yet.
Video reviews
0 review(s)
Text reviews
0 review(s)